As the use of stablecoins like USDT continues to grow across Nigeria and beyond, understanding how they work on different networks is essential. One of the most commonly used formats for USDT is the TRC20 version, built on the TRON blockchain.
If you’re receiving, sending, or storing USDT in 2025, you’re likely interacting with TRC20 more than any other version.
But to use it effectively and avoid costly mistakes, you need to understand what the Usdt TRC20 contract address is and how to use it properly.
This guide explains what it means, how it compares to other types like ERC20 and BEP20, and how to use it safely for everyday crypto activity.
What Is a USDT TRC20 Contract Address?

A USDT TRC20 contract address is the official “blueprint” of the USDT token on the TRON blockchain. It tells the network how the token behaves, how it interacts with wallets and exchanges, and how transactions should be validated.
It’s different from your personal wallet address.
Think of the contract address like a reference point. It’s not where you store your USDT, but it’s how wallets and platforms recognize what USDT TRC20 is and how to handle it.
For example, here’s the official TRC20 USDT contract address (for reference):
TL7kGfJx9BrCBwB7DgmdgHk27tnp5PBkdd
This address remains the same across all platforms that support TRC20 USDT. You don’t send funds here. Instead, your personal TRC20 wallet address allows you to receive USDT issued under this contract.
What Is TRC20 and How Is It Different?

TRC20 is a smart contract standard on the TRON blockchain. It defines how tokens behave, including how they are created, transferred, and stored. USDT built on TRC20 benefits from the TRON blockchain’s speed and low transaction costs.
Compared to other versions of USDT, TRC20 stands out because transactions confirm in seconds, fees are extremely low, and it works with wallets like TronLink, Trust Wallet, and ZendWallet.
Here’s how it compares to other common USDT formats:
TRC20 USDT runs on the TRON network. It’s known for being fast and cost-effective. Transactions usually confirm in under a minute, and fees are just a few cents or even lower. Wallet addresses for TRC20 start with a “T”.
This version is ideal for anyone looking to save on fees and time, especially freelancers, businesses, and everyday users.
ERC20 USDT is built on the Ethereum network.
It is widely supported but often comes with high transaction fees due to Ethereum’s gas costs. It may take several minutes or more for a transaction to go through, and fees can range from a few dollars to over $20, depending on how busy the network is. Wallet addresses for ERC20 start with “0x”. This version is best for users already operating within Ethereum-based platforms.
BEP20 USDT operates on the BNB Smart Chain. It also offers fast speeds and low fees like TRC20. BEP20 addresses also start with “0x”, which can be confusing if you’re not careful. BEP20 is a good choice for users who rely heavily on the Binance ecosystem.
Related: Convert Tether USDT to TRON TRX on ZendWallet: A Full Beginner’s Guide
What Is a Contract Address?

A contract address defines how a token operates on the blockchain. For USDT on TRC20, this address serves as the token’s official origin on the TRON network.
Unlike your personal wallet address, the contract address acts as a blueprint, guiding the network on how USDT should appear and function. This enables wallets and exchanges to correctly identify and support the token.
Why Network Type is Important in Crypto
USDT always equals $1, no matter the network. But the way it’s transferred and stored depends on the network standard.
Sending the wrong version of USDT to a wallet that doesn’t support it can result in lost funds. For example, sending TRC20 USDT to an ERC20 wallet may lead to a failed transaction or unrecoverable tokens.
That’s why choosing the correct USDT network and understanding your wallet’s compatibility is crucial before you send or receive crypto.
When Do You Need a USDT TRC20 Wallet Address?
You need a TRC20-compatible address in several situations:
1. To Receive USDT from Another Person
If someone is sending you USDT via the TRON network, they’ll ask for your TRC20 wallet address.
These addresses typically start with a “T.” If you give them an ERC20 address by mistake, the funds may never arrive.
2. To Withdraw from an Exchange
Most exchanges like Binance, KuCoin, or Bitget let you choose the network for USDT withdrawals. TRC20 is often the cheapest option. You’ll need a wallet that supports TRC20 to use it.
3. To Reduce Transfer Fees
If you regularly send or receive USDT, TRC20 will help you save money on transaction fees. It’s a smart choice for freelancers, traders, and people who receive international payments.
4. To Avoid Ethereum Gas Costs
Ethereum’s network fees can be unpredictable and expensive. TRC20 gives you the same value in USDT without the high gas fees.
5. To Send Money Internationally
If you’re sending USDT across borders, using TRC20 ensures the transaction is processed quickly and with minimal cost.
Just make sure both sender and receiver are using TRC20 addresses.
Related: The Best USDT Trading Platform in Nigeria: A Complete Guide in 2025
Common Mistakes to Avoid when Using USDT TRC20 Contract Address

Even though TRC20 is fast and affordable, it’s important to avoid some common errors that can lead to lost funds or other problems:
Double-Check the Network Type
Never assume that all USDT wallet addresses are the same. Always verify that both you and the person you’re transacting with are using TRC20.
Avoid Fake Wallet Apps or Websites
Only use trusted wallets like ZendWallet, Trust Wallet, or TronLink. Stay away from random sites offering quick wallet generation without verification.
Look Out for Hidden Exchange Fees
Even on TRC20, some platforms charge high withdrawal fees. Always check the fee breakdown before completing a withdrawal.
Protect Your Private Keys
Never share your wallet’s private key or recovery phrase. Store it in a safe offline location. Anyone who has it can access and drain your funds.
Test with a Small Transaction
Before sending a large amount of USDT to someone new or a new address, send a small amount first to confirm everything works properly.
How to Get a USDT TRC20 Wallet Address
If you need a TRC20 address to receive or store USDT, here’s how to get one:
Use ZendWallet (Recommended)
- Go to zendwallet.com or download the app
- Sign up and log in
- Select “USDT” and choose the “TRC20” network
- Your TRC20 address will appear and start with a “T”
ZendWallet makes it easy to switch between networks and ensures that you’re using the correct address for each transaction.
Why ZendWallet Works Well with TRC20
ZendWallet is designed for users in Nigeria who need speed, safety, and ease when dealing with USDT. With ZendWallet, you can:
- Receive TRC20 USDT instantly
- Swap to naira without stress
- Track your crypto balance in real time
- Avoid confusion about which network you’re using
- Get customer support when you need it
ZendWallet offers a dependable solution for managing, sending, and receiving USDT TRC20, catering to both new crypto users and those seeking quick cash-outs.
Conclusion
The USDT TRC20 contract address plays a key role in helping wallets and platforms recognize and process Tether on the TRON blockchain.
By understanding how it works, choosing the correct wallet, and staying alert to common mistakes, you can confidently send and receive USDT without problems.
If you’re looking for a fast, stress-free way to use USDT TRC20 and access cash in Nigeria, ZendWallet offers the reliability you need, right from your phone or browser.